What is an MICR Code?

MICR stands for Magnetic Ink Character Recognition. Banks use this technology to speed up and secure cheque processing. The numbers printed at the bottom of a cheque are produced with magnetic ink so machines can reliably read them, even if the cheque is slightly damaged or wet.

What is a MICR code in Banking?

In banking, the MICR code is a unique nine-digit number assigned to each bank branch. It enables cheques to be routed efficiently through the central clearing system managed by the Reserve Bank of India.

MICR Code Structure

The MICR code is divided into three parts:

Digits Meaning
First 3 digits City code (aligned with PIN code region)
Next 3 digits Bank code
Last 3 digits Branch code

For example, if the MICR code is 400002005:

  • 400 → Mumbai (city code)
  • 002 → Bank code
  • 005 → Specific branch

This structured format helps automated clearing systems identify and route the cheque correctly.

Why Do We Use MICR in Banking?

Although electronic payments such as UPI and internet banking have grown rapidly, MICR remains useful for several reasons:

  • Faster cheque clearing: MICR enables automatic reading of cheque data, reducing manual processing time.
  • Fewer errors: Machines read magnetic ink, which reduces the chance of human data-entry mistakes.
  • Fraud prevention: The special magnetic ink and standardized format are difficult to forge or reproduce accurately.
  • Secure disbursement via cheque: For cases where banks issue loans or payments by cheque, MICR ensures funds are routed to the correct branch without delay.

For example, when a bank issues a large business loan by cheque, the MICR code ensures the cheque reaches the appropriate clearing branch and that payment is processed promptly.

MICR vs IFSC – Where are They Used?

MICR and IFSC are often confused, but they serve different purposes:

Feature MICR IFSC
Used for Cheque clearing Electronic transfers
Format 9-digit numeric 11-character alphanumeric
Governing authority RBI RBI
Used in Physical cheque processing NEFT, RTGS, IMPS and other online fund transfers

Where each is used:

  • MICR code → Cheque clearing systems
  • IFSC code → Electronic fund transfer systems such as NEFT, RTGS and IMPS

Electronic platforms process millions of transactions daily, while MICR continues to support standardized cheque clearing across branches.

FAQs about MICR

What does MICR stand for in a bank account?

MICR in banking is a nine-digit code printed on cheques that identifies the issuing bank branch. It differs from an account number and is used for cheque clearance and verification.

Is MICR the same as an account number?

No.

  • Account number → Identifies an individual bank account.
  • MICR code → Identifies the bank branch.

They serve different purposes within banking operations.

What is a 9-digit MICR number?

A 9-digit MICR number is a branch identification code used specifically for cheque processing. It includes a 3-digit city code, a 3-digit bank code, and a 3-digit branch code, which together help route cheques through the central clearing system.
